West Ashland Fire Station

West Ashland Fire Station is the newest in the Service. It forms part of the Blue-Light Hub in Milton Keynes. It opened on Tuesday 30 June 2020 replacing Bletchley Fire Station and Great Holm Fire Station, bringing together all the crews, staff and fire appliances under one roof.

The Blue-Light Hub is also home to teams from Thames Valley Police and South Central Ambulance Service, which create opportunities for collaborative working with our emergency service partners.

The fire station provides full-time cover across a vast area of Milton Keynes and the surrounding areas. In addition to responding to incidents, the crews proactively seek to protect the community through prevention activities in the area.
